Preparing paperwork
If you’re planning to ship a car, you’ll need to ensure it’s ready for the trip. This involves ensuring it’s in top condition, taking pictures to ensure no hidden defects, and documenting any damage you may find.
You might be moving across the country or taking a road trip, and you’ll need to prepare your car for the journey. Whether you’re shipping a classic or a newer vehicle, there are certain things you’ll need to do to ensure your car makes the journey safely and efficiently.
First, you’ll want to pick up a few documents. These should include a bill of lading. The statement will outline the car’s departure and arrival locations, as well as the terms of the shipping process. It should also include the car’s current mileage.
Next, you’ll need a good insurance plan. An insurance policy will help protect you against damages in transit. Ensure it includes coverage for any items in the car that may be lost or stolen.
In addition, you’ll need to get a notarized letter. This should contain the requisite information, such as your and company names. Also, it should include the VIN and a representative’s name.
Air freight
Shipping a car by air freight is one of the fastest ways to get your vehicle from point A to point B. It’s also safe and secure. However, there are some rules that you should be aware of.

It would help if you also took note of the timeframe for your shipment. If you need it to arrive by a specific date, choose a company that can provide expedited service.
Air freight is costly, especially compared to other modes of transport. Often, you’ll find that it’s two or three times more expensive.
This is because air freight charges are based on the actual weight of the cargo. Cars are shipped in special wooden crates, and high-strength fabric straps are used to ensure they don’t move during the journey.
Another advantage of air shipping is that there’s less handling than other methods. This means there’s less chance that your car will be damaged or hijacked.
